Chimney sweeping is the physical act of removing soot and creosote from the inside of your chimney. Chimney cleaning is a broader term that encompasses sweeping, along with a detailed inspection for any damage or blockages. Both are essential for chimney safety.

The time required for a professional chimney cleaning can vary. Factors include the chimney's size and the extent of creosote buildup. Most standard cleanings take about an hour. We strive for efficiency while ensuring a complete and thorough service.
In New Hampshire, it is recommended to have your chimney cleaned and inspected annually. This is especially important if you use your fireplace or wood stove regularly during the cold winter months. Annual maintenance helps prevent dangerous creosote buildup.
